The German Development Institute / Deutsches Institut für Entwicklungspolitik (DIE) has six independent publication series: Briefing Paper, Analysen und Stellungnahmen, Studies, Discussion Paper and Two-Pager / Zweiseiter. From time to time, research fellows also have the possibility to publish their research findings in one of the DIE publication series.
Every Monday, the DIE comments on the latest trends and issues in international development policy by its Current Column.
Besides, DIE researchers publish their research results on a regular basis in respective national and international journals as well as with other renowned publishers.
